## Onboarding — SheetForge Export Memory

SheetForge builds spreadsheet exports by streaming rows, not buffering. Exports over 500k rows previously OOM'd the worker; the streaming writer fixed that. Rules: never load a full result set, always use the cursor helper, keep batch size at 2k. Memory regressions show up in the nightly export benchmark — check it before merging. To run the benchmark locally, point the worker at the staging dataset using the connection string below.

primary connection of yagep-kahip = redis://giliel_svc:zYiKsLL2PLpfPL@db-348f.xolmarsys.corp:5432/fenwyn

## Authentication

The Inkrelay spooler microservice accepts only bearer-authenticated requests on its submission and status endpoints. Tokens are minted by the Copperfen identity service with a 12-hour lifetime and are scoped per print queue; a token for the `legal-floor3` queue cannot enumerate jobs elsewhere. Anonymous access is disabled in every environment, including local compose setups. For review purposes, the test environment honors the bearer token below.

session JWT of hahif-fawif = eyJhbGciOiJIUzI1NiIsInR5cCI6IkpXVCJ9.eyJzdWIiOiI04_V2KayaDIn0.-jKHPhS5t5LS

Re: Retirement of the Stonebriar product line

Stonebriar sales have declined for five consecutive quarters and support costs now exceed contribution margin. The retirement plan is staged: new orders close end of Q2, existing contracts honoured through their terms, and spares stocked for twenty-four months. Sales leads should steer prospects toward the Ashgrove range; migration incentives are already approved. Customer comms are drafted and awaiting legal sign-off. The forward strategy behind this decision is set out in the note below.

confidential, yafog-hagug: Gross margin on Druix came in at 10 percent against a plan of 15 percent. Only 5 of the 80 pilot accounts renewed Druix, so a churn review is set for October 1.